Jeff Jeannette
Principal, Lead Architect & Designer

Jeff Jeannette understands the delicate balance between the built structure and its impact on the environment. He is a Certified Green Building Professional (CGBP) through Build it Green, affiliated with the United States Green Building Council (USGBC) and the American Institute of Architects (AIA) among other groups.

Jeff began his career in the field framing homes; gaining a balanced understanding of connections, details, and how homes are truly built. His early construction knowledge makes him a more creative and well rounded architect both in design and detailing.

Receiving his architectural degree from the University of Arizona in 1994, Jeff now specializes in custom residential architectural design for new homes and remodels. He listens intently to your desires and goals working with you to develop a home in which you and your family will feel comfortable living.

Laura Sanders
Project Manager, Design

Laura joined Jeannette Architects in 2007 and has climbed to a Project Management position. Working alongside Jeff, she assists with design, production, job coordination, and client interaction. She develops Jeff’s Schematic Design and Meeting sketches to Preliminary Design plans in CAD, our drafting program. She integrates closely with Jeremy making sure Jeff's design intensions are followed through in the final drawing set. She also interacts with the contractors for field questions as they arise during construction.

Graduating with a Bachelor of Architecture degree from Roger Williams University, Rhode Island in 2004, she spent a semester abroad in Florence, Italy immersing herself in Italian culture and architectural forms. Many of the historical and modern-day buildings throughout have shaped her design concepts and process.

Laura enjoys learning and integrating green systems into our homes. She has an extensive history in residential architecture and is in the examination stages to secure her Architectural License; her ultimate professional goal.

Jeremy Phillips
Production Lead

Jeremy started with Jeannette Architects in 2009 to fill a position as Production Lead; the development of the detailed Construction Documents and Drawings. He receives the Preliminary Design Plans from Laura from which to draft the final drawing and detail set of plans. He interacts with clients, coordinates project consultants and submits the document plans to City / County Plan Check review.

With early career hands on experience in construction and an Associate’s Degree from Long Beach City College with a focus in Architecture, he details plans carefully and methodically following through with Building Department reviews and Contractor Interaction in the field.

Jeremy works closely with Laura and Jeff in the final stages of Construction Document development, ensuring the design intent is carried through in the plans.
